CNN’s Wilkinson takes on international role

David Wilkinson

CNN has named David Wilkinson director of international planning, a role where he’ll oversee planning of international news coverage and events globally for the network’s platforms. Previously, Wilkinson served as a senior planning editor.

During his 14 years at CNN, he has also worked as a news producer/assignment editor, and producer for special projects. He worked at the BBC and Absolute Radio.

Wilkinson has a BSc. from the University of St Andrews and a M.A. from City, University of London.
